Garrison Hearst won the Doak Walker Award in 1992. Hearst attended school in Georgia where he was a running back.
Ron Dayne won the Doak Walker Award in 1999. Dayne played for the University of Wisconsin before joining the NFL Giants.
Luke Staley won the Doak Walker award in 2001. Born in 1980 Staley was a running back for Brigham Young University.
Trevor Cobb was the winner of the Doak Walker Award in 1991. Cobb played for the Rice Owls at Rice University.
Byron "Bam" Morris won the Doak Walker Award in 1993. Byron Morris attended school at Texas Tech and he went on to play in the NFL.

Greg Lewis won the Doak Walker award in 1990. Lewis attended school at Washington State and he went on to play one season in the NFL.
The Doak Walker Award was first awarded in 1990, and honors top running backs in American college football. In 2003, the recipient of this award was Chris Perry, who played for Michigan.
